Air Canada just blew away all earnings estimates. Now were starting to understand why Onex wants to steal this company so badly. EPS of 65 cents and Cash Flow of $1.10 in the latest quarter. These numbers are very good. Onex can forget about getting Air Canada for $8.25 or even $12.25, it's not on.

The great thing is that Air Canada didn't just report blowout numbers, they also decided to poke Onex in the eye by signing a 10-year agreement with Cara. It's great!
